Translation of hyperaesthesia into German

Noun

medical

TECH.UK
increased sensitivity to sensory stimuli
TECH.UK
Hyperästhesie fÜberempfindlichkeit
  • After the accident, she experienced hyperaesthesia, making even soft touches painful..Nach dem Unfall erlebte sie Hyperästhesie, wodurch selbst sanfte Berührungen schmerzhaft wurden
